I’ve just found out that I am pregnant with my second. First DC is only 10 months so there will be roughly 18 months apart. Im spiralling and wondering how on earth we will cope with 2 under 2! Please can you let me know your experiences?

AelinoftheWildfire · 07/12/2025 21:51

I've a 12 month gap between my two. Pregnancy and the first 2 years were the hardest for me (I had two non-sleepers) but after that things became infinitely more manageable.

It'll be hard, but any age gap has it's pros and cons and you're already in it now so the decision of what's the "best" age gap has been resolved for you (I don't believe there is a best age gap but I prefer mine over what I've seen over most of my friends!).

There really are loads of benefits, it's just hard to imagine it now. You'll get there though!

Wherestheteenguide · 09/12/2025 22:19

I had three within two years. Yes it was chaos but also loads of fun. They're all close and we got through the stages at the same time so less tiring for example than a baby, a nursery run and school.
